Sulky rayon thread
 
Can I use sulky 40wt rayon thread to machine quilt? I've done a small section & it looks great. I love the sheen. Then I had to take out a small section and noticed that the thread really frays. I hesitate to go further until I know the thread will hold up. The quilt is for a 5yr old and will get some heavy use and probably be washed fairly often. Your thots on the thread and alternate thread ideas are welcome. Thanks

Tartan 11-03-2018 12:13 PM

Those lovely rayons are tempting for sure. Rayon thread does fray and is weaker then other threads and not a good candidate for a child’s quilt. I have used it on a wall hanging though.

ckcowl 11-03-2018 02:04 PM

Rayon will not hold up on a quilt that will be used. It is most often used for machine embroidery and wall hangings that will never be laundered.

feline fanatic 11-03-2018 02:15 PM

Rayon is notoriously weak and is often not colorfast. I would not use it for quilting. If you love shiney thread most trilobal polyesters will fit the bill. You should consider Glide, Superior Magnifico, Isacord or Metro Embroidery thread. The metro site carries Metro and Glide. The Metro is very reasonably priced and the colors are very shiny.
